Registering Developer Account in Thailand has been a failure and nightmare

For 26 days now I have been trying to register and pay for a new developer account in Thailand. The experience has been a complete and total disaster and failure at every step of the way.

I am at my wit's end and decided to register in the forums and share my experience with the hope of attracting a resolution.

This has materially hurt my business financially and competitively. I have been paying developers for almost 4 weeks now who have nothing to do because of this problem.

I have sent multiple emails, voice emails, made phone calls, international phone calls, all at our expense of time and money.

In contrast the Google Play account was opened and paid for within 24hrs on the same day.

Problems I have experienced with Apple:

  1. DUNS number didn't match business name despite Apple themselves sending me our DUNS number after its own lookup of our business name. Application rejected.

  2. Apple Developer App is unable to register new account from my iphone following the suggestion of Apple to use the app to register. Multiple error messages. Unable to register.

  3. After attempting again from a desktop to register, we entered payment information. Application unable to accept US Based credit cards, paypal, Thai prompt pay, bank transfer or Thai checking account. We paid with Thai debit card - card was successfully charged and I assumed account was open.

  4. After this payment, we were still not getting access in the account portal to add other admins and devs. So I contacted Apple and was told to reregister a new account. This was not an option as we already paid.

  5. After 2 weeks, our payment was reverted and refunded with no explanation whatsoever. Every back and forth email with Apple has taken 4 days or no response at all. There is no direct phone support with the payment department. Application was closed.

  6. After starting a new application from scratch, I called the Apple developer support center in Singapore. The issue was escalated and I was able to speak with a native english speaker. She informed me it would be 2-3 days for a response/resolution. It has been another week.

As of now, it has been 26 days of this. Frustrated doesn't appropriately begin to describe how me and my team are feeling.

This entire experience has been nothing short of a trainwreck. As of now we still do not have a developer account open and devs are still sitting doing nothing. I have no choice but to persist and endure with Apple because they have a monopoly on the App Store.
